On Fri, Sep 22, 2006 at 07:06:30PM +0400, Samium Gromoff wrote:

> How reliable is 16KB PAGE_SIZE on r4k-likes in kernels around 2.6.17?
> 
> Is it known to work?

it's certainly not as well tested as 4k pages but several people have
reported success, most recently also on 32-bit kernels.

Btw, r4k is a bit ambigous, did you mean R4000 or 4K?
